Director of Special Education SAU 6 is seeking a New Hampshire-certified Director of Special Education to oversee all special ed programs and program implementation in Claremont's public schools. Claremont is entering a rebuilding period under new, experienced school leadership after a serious, public financial crisis. The new superintendent is seeking experienced administrators to help implement needed reforms that will improve compliance, student outcomes, and fiscal responsibility. Qualified candidates are urged to think of this as an opportunity to make a lasting difference in a school system whose staff and students deserve your leadership.
